What instrument makes bass in rap?

Bass. The bass in trap is commonly known as an “808”, referring to the bass drum of the TR-808 drum machine. The sound itself is very easy to reproduce with a basic sine wave on a synth, and that way you can play it like an instrument.

Who was the 1st female rapper?

Sharon Green (born 1962), considered the “first female rapper” or emcee, known by the rap moniker MC Sha-Rock. Born in Wilmington, North Carolina, she grew up in the South Bronx, New York City during the earliest years of hip hop culture.

What kind of instruments are used in rap music?

Few things are more emblematic of rap music than a musician or “turntablist” hunched over two “decks,” using his hands to manipulate the records. The turntables provide the opportunity to make very simple and basic samples from previously existing material.
